In the title compound, C(25)H(29)BrN(4)O(3)S(2), the benzene rings bridged by the sulfonamide group are tilted relative to each other by 63.9 (1)° and the dihedral angle between the sulfur-bridged pyrimidine and benzene rings is 64.9 (1)°. The mol-ecular conformation is stabilized by a weak intra-molecular π-π stacking inter-action between the pyrimidine and the 2,4,6-trimethyl-benzene rings [centroid-centroid distance = 3.766 (2) Å]. The piperidine ring adopts a chair conformation. In the crystal, mol-ecules are linked into inversion dimers by pairs of N-H⋯O hydrogen bonds and these dimers are further linked by C-H⋯O hydrogen bonds into chains propagating along [010].
